Abstract

The utility model provides a demountable magazine type small material supply mechanism, which comprises a guide cylinder, a material cup, a cup feeding cylinder, a cup receiving jig and a slope cup baffle plate, the material cup is arranged in the guide cylinder and is in sliding fit with the guide cylinder, the cup feeding cylinder is connected with the cup receiving jig, the slope cup blocking plate is arranged on one side of the cup receiving jig, the cup receiving groove matched with the material cup is formed in the other side of the cup receiving jig, the cup receiving jig is positioned at the bottom of the guide cylinder, the cup feeding cylinder drives the cup receiving jig to reciprocate at a cup receiving position and a cup feeding position, when the cup receiving jig is at the cup receiving position, the cup receiving groove of the cup receiving jig is positioned right below the guide cylinder to receive the material cup, when the cup receiving jig is at the cup feeding position, the slope cup blocking plate of the cup receiving jig is located right below the guide cylinder so as to block the falling of the material cup. The utility model has the advantages that: the automatic feeding of small materials can be realized, and the automation degree is higher.

Detailed Description
The present invention will be further described with reference to the following description and embodiments.
As shown in fig. 1 to 7, a demountable magazine type small material supply mechanism comprises a guide cylinder 2, a material cup 1, a cup feeding cylinder 7, a cup receiving jig 8 and a slope cup blocking plate 9, wherein the material cup 1 is arranged in the guide cylinder 2 and is in sliding fit with the guide cylinder 2, the material cup 1 can freely slide in the guide cylinder 2, the cup feeding cylinder 7 is connected with the cup receiving jig 8, the slope cup blocking plate 9 is arranged on one side of the cup receiving jig 8, a cup receiving groove matched with the material cup 1 is formed in the other side of the cup receiving jig 8 and is used for receiving a cup, the cup receiving jig 8 is located at the bottom of the guide cylinder 2, the cup feeding cylinder 7 drives the cup receiving jig 8 to reciprocate at a cup receiving position and a cup feeding position, and when the cup receiving jig 8 is at the cup receiving position, the cup receiving groove of the cup receiving jig 8 is located right below the guide cylinder 2 to receive the material cup 1, when the cup receiving jig 8 is at the cup feeding position, the slope cup blocking plate 9 of the cup receiving jig 8 is positioned under the guide cylinder 2 to block the falling of the material cup 1.
As shown in fig. 1 to 7, the guide cylinder 2 is connected with a positioning device.
As shown in fig. 1 to 7, the positioning device includes a secondary positioning jig 3, a positioning pin 4 and a jig support plate 5, the secondary positioning jig 3 is connected to the guide cylinder 2, the jig support plate 5 is connected to the guide cylinder 2 through the positioning pin 4, and the guide cylinder 2 can be positioned and mounted by the positioning device, so as to accurately control the height of the guide cylinder 2.
As shown in fig. 1 to 7, an annular flange 21 is arranged on the outer side wall of the guide cylinder 2, a positioning hole matched with the positioning pin 4 is arranged on the annular flange 21, an arc-shaped groove 51 matched with the guide cylinder 2 is arranged on the jig supporting plate 5, the positioning pin 4 is arranged around the arc-shaped groove 51, the guide cylinder 2 is arranged in the arc-shaped groove 51, the positioning pin 4 is arranged in the positioning hole, and the positioning pin 4 is used for quick positioning, so that the guide cylinder 2 can be quickly loaded and disassembled.
As shown in fig. 1 to 7, the arc-shaped groove 51 may be provided in plurality for mounting a plurality of guide cylinders 2.
As shown in fig. 1 to 7, a handle avoiding channel 22 passing through the guide cylinder 2 from top to bottom is formed on a side wall of the guide cylinder, and a handle of the material cup 1 is located in the handle avoiding channel 22.
As shown in fig. 1 to 7, the removable magazine type small material supply mechanism further includes a material shortage sensor 6 for detecting whether the material cup 1 is present in the guide cylinder 2.
As shown in fig. 1 to 7, a ball plunger 10 is arranged on the guide cylinder 2, and the ball plunger 10 transversely extends to block the falling of the material cup 1; rotating 90 degrees and pulling back, the material cup 1 falls freely.
The utility model provides a demountable magazine type small material supply mechanism, wherein a cup feeding cylinder 7 is a rodless cylinder, the cup feeding cylinder 7 extends forwards to push out the lowest cup 1, and a slope cup blocking plate 9 blocks the bottom cup to finish the feeding of the cup 1; after the material cup 1 is taken away in the upper work, the cup feeding cylinder 7 is condensed backwards, and the secondary cup slowly falls onto the cup receiving jig 8 due to the slope, so that one-time cup separating work is completed.
The utility model provides a pair of demountable magazine formula small powder feed mechanism, its specific work flow is as follows:
1. the ball plunger 10 is stretched and screwed for 90 degrees to make the ball self-lock when the ball extends out.
2. The material cup 1 is placed into the guide cylinder 2 once (the ball plunger 10 extends out to block the material cup from descending).
3. The charging barrel 2 is installed from front to back, after the arc-shaped groove 51 of the jig supporting plate 5 is clamped to the guide barrel 2, the guide barrel is downwards inserted into the positioning pin 4.
4. The ball plunger 10 is stretched and screwed for 90 degrees to reset, so that the ball is withdrawn and self-locked.
5. The cup feeding cylinder 7 withdraws the material cup 1 at the bottommost layer, and the material cup 1 slowly falls onto the material receiving jig 8 due to the slope.
6. And when the material shortage sensor 6 senses that the material cup exists, the loading of the material cup 1 is finished, and an upper position giving signal is waited.
7. An upper feeding signal is sent, the cup feeding cylinder 7 extends out, and the slope cup blocking plate 9 blocks the material cups 1 on the secondary layer to realize material distribution.
8. The upper computer takes the cup away, and the small materials in the material cup 1 are poured into the milk tea cup to complete the supply of the small materials.
9. The cup feeding cylinder 7 is retracted, the secondary layer cups are lowered onto the cup receiving jig 8 to wait for next cup feeding, and accordingly the cup feeding is repeated until the material shortage sensor 6 cannot detect the material cup 1, the material cups 1 in the guide cylinder 2 are completely supplied, the empty guide cylinder 2 is taken out at the moment, and the guide cylinder 2 is newly loaded.
The utility model provides a pair of demountable magazine formula small powder feed mechanism, guide 2 can be dismantled and the loading fast, the user can prepare two and above guide 2, the storage cup quantity has been increased, take out after the guide 2 replacement and carry the cup, can reduce complete machine downtime, high efficiency, the cleanness of guide 2 is also more convenient, also can place cold-stored fresh-keeping with guide 2 that the dress cup is full, increase the save time of small powder, make people more reasonable arrangement time, high efficiency.
